Hi, I has a question about the license of gnutls, I don't know whether it is a bug.
In gnutls-3.6.13/LICENSE, the content is as following: ------------------------------------------------------------------ LICENSING ========= Since GnuTLS version 3.1.10, the core library is released under the GNU Lesser General Public License (LGPL) version 2.1 or later (see doc/COPYING.LESSER for the license terms). The GNU LGPL applies to the main GnuTLS library, while the included applications as well as gnutls-openssl library are under the GNU GPL version 3. The gnutls library is located in the lib/ and libdane/ directories, while the applications in src/ and, the gnutls-openssl library is at extra/. ...... ------------------------------------------------------------------ I think it means that all the license in lib/ is under the license of LGPL-2.1+. But the license of lib/x509/krb5.h and lib/x509/krb5.c is GPL-3.0+. Obviously, it is conflict with the content of LICENSE file. So, I don't know is it a bug or do I understand.
